Hi, I need to allow Japanese characters to post in my forums.
The interface is all in English but some of the post themselves would be in Japanese.
I changed the Charset to utf8 in the language editor but there still seems to be some problem. Is there a setting in the database itself that prevents these characters from posting?
I am still behind on updating -- 7.4 and working on getting up to date. (Editing the templates every update is time consuming)
Does the latest version work or what changes do I need to make?

There are a few things in the current version that make it pretty tough to get it working flawlessly with existing data in the database. The collation and charset need to be changed on the tables, the problem being you can just do a straight convert due to the fulltext indexing, potential data loss, etc.
We're going to address this in 8.0 during the upgrade process.
